House leveling services involve adjusting and stabilizing a building’s foundation to correct uneven or sagging floors, cracks, and other structural issues. These projects typically address situations where the soil beneath the property has shifted, causing the foundation to settle unevenly. Homeowners often request house leveling to improve safety, prevent further damage, and restore the structural integrity of their property, especially after noticing signs like sloping floors, cracked walls, or sticking doors and windows.

Before requesting house leveling, property owners usually want to understand the extent of the foundation issues, the methods used for stabilization, and how the process may impact their property. It’s important to assess whether the project involves minor adjustments or requires more extensive underpinning or foundation repair. Clear communication about the scope of work, potential disruptions, and long-term stability can help homeowners make informed decisions about restoring their home’s level and safety.

Common House Leveling Jobs

Foundation leveling - raises and stabilizes uneven or sinking home foundations to ensure structural integrity.

Slab stabilization - addresses uneven concrete slabs to prevent cracks and improve safety.

Pier and beam leveling - corrects shifting or settling in homes with pier and beam foundations.

Basement floor leveling - repairs uneven basement floors to support proper drainage and usability.

Crawl space leveling - stabilizes and supports homes with crawl space foundations for long-term stability.

Structural repair services - reinforces and restores the stability of compromised or damaged foundation elements.

House Leveling Questions

What is house leveling? House leveling involves adjusting a building’s foundation to correct uneven settling and ensure stability.

When is house leveling needed? It is typically required when a structure shows signs of uneven floors, cracks in walls, or foundation shifts.

What methods are used for house leveling? Common techniques include pier and beam adjustments, mudjacking, or underpinning to restore levelness.

Are house leveling services disruptive? The process is planned to minimize disruption, focusing on stabilizing the foundation efficiently and safely.
